XCM Challenge Terms and Conditions
1. Acceptance of Challenge Terms
By participating in the XCM (Xeon Car Meets) challenge on the games 'Automation - The Car Company Tycoon Game' and 'BeamNG.drive', you agree to comply with and be bound by the following terms and conditions.
2. Terms of Submissions
a. Rule Changes: Entrants must respect changes to the rules brought upon by XCM, competition challenge creators, and the testing team. These rules are subject to change due to re-balancing and alterations in game mechanics during development.
b. Disqualification: XCM, challenge creators, and the testing team reserve the right to remove any submission that does not meet criteria standards. Additionally, individuals who violate these rules or infringe on the safety, wellbeing, or comfort of any XCM challenge creators, team, and staff may be banned from the challenge.
c. Editing and Distribution: When vehicles are submitted, you allow XCM, challenge creators, and the testing team (determined by the challenge creators) to edit, change, and distribute internally the .car file of the vehicle. This includes colours, engines and fixtures.
d. Content Usage: You consent to the use of your vehicle, marque, and technical details in the creation and distribution of content, images, and videos. Reviews made by XCM may also include the use and distribution of a file compatible with the game BeamNG.drive.
e. Naming and Language Restrictions: XCM prohibits the use of derogatory terms, hate speech, or explicit and profane language in any vehicles submitted, including but not limited to lore, make, model, or any submitted facet.
f. Age Requirement for Prizes: XCM Prize Stages and winning of Prizes will only be available to those who are over the age of 18 years. Validation for submissions to those winners may be required by the XCM testing team.

4. XCM Values
The XCM team will sim to follow the following values when conducting our challenges.
a. Fairness: We won’t allow for the use of DLC, Mods or Workshop content in any of the submitted vehicles. We will only accept the .car file of submissions and those submissions must not be edited or tampered with in any part other than through normal gameplay. Judges will never win prizes on vehicle stages or prizes that they will judge on.
b. Honesty: Judges will be required to maintain that .car files of users will never intentionally be distributed openly outside of XCM testing and judging crew members. We won’t accept plagiarism of vehicles. Vehicles submitted to XCM Challenge must be original and not a copy or modified copy made by someone else. Any exploits of the game should be revealed in the submission form, it will be up to the XCM Challenge judges to decide whether these will be allowed.
c. Factuality: All vehicles of that submission class will be subjected to the same testing. Testing methods that are openly disclosed to anyone in the Testing Metrics. For vehicles that pass, the results that we get will be published freely. We will be open to arbitrating on large amounts of discrepancy between our testing data and your own results.
